I was unaware of the importance of git gc until today after investigating a problem with "git pull". So there hasn't been run git gc on the repository ever. The biggest file in the repository is a 45 mb file. The repository size is near 2 gb. What can I do? $ git gc Counting objects: 5934, done. warning: suboptimal pack - out of memory fatal: Out of memory, malloc failed8) error: failed to run repack $ git --version git version 1.6.5.2 $ uname -a OpenBSD amiga.opcoders.com 4.3 GENERIC#698 i386 $ ulimit -a time(cpu-seconds) unlimited file(blocks) unlimited coredump(blocks) unlimited data(kbytes) 524288 stack(kbytes) 4096 lockedmem(kbytes) 662576 memory(kbytes) 1985524 nofiles(descriptors) 128 processes 64 $ du -ks myrepository.git 1859538 myrepository.git $ Below is the "git pull" problem I'm having. I think its caused by the former problem. When pulling it dies because of malloc failure. prompt> git pull remote: Counting objects: 280, done. remote: fatal: Out of memory, malloc failed error: git upload-pack: git-pack-objects died with error. fatal: git upload-pack: aborting due to possible repository corruption on the remote side. remote: aborting due to possible repository corruption on the remote side. fatal: protocol error: bad pack header prompt> git --version git version 1.6.5.2 prompt> uname -a Darwin pidgin.local 9.8.0 Darwin Kernel Version 9.8.0: Wed Jul 15 16:55:01 PDT 2009; root:xnu-1228.15.4~1/RELEASE_I386 i386 i386 prompt> sw_vers ProductName: Mac OS X ProductVersion: 10.5.8 BuildVersion: 9L31a prompt> Kind regards Simon Strandgaard - http://gdtoolbox.com/
